随着比特币及其他加密货币的深入人心,数字资产的安全性愈发重要。在这其中,多重签名技术作为比特币钱包安全的一种保障机制,正逐渐受到关注。多重签名技术不仅能提高数字资产的安全性,还能为用户提供更加灵活的资产管理方式。本文将深入探讨比特币钱包中的多重签名,分析其工作原理、优势以及应用场景,并解答一些相关的问题。
一、多重签名的基本概念
多重签名(Multisignature,简称为多签)是一种安全协议,它需要多个密钥来批准一项交易。这一技术常被用于比特币钱包中,以增强数字资产的安全性。与传统数字签名不同,多重签名需要两个或两个以上的签名才能构成有效交易,从而避免单个私钥被盗或丢失导致财产的损失。
在多重签名机制中,通常会有几个参与者(共事者)。例如,在一个2-of-3的多重签名钱包中,用户将三个私钥分配给三个不同的人,任何两个参与者的签名加在一起就足以执行交易。这种机制使得即使一个参与者的密钥被盗,攻击者也无法单独控制资产。
二、多重签名的工作原理
多重签名的工作原理基于比特币的脚本语言,通过定义一个脚本,规定何种条件下可以执行交易。该脚本通常采用hash256算法,对多个密钥进行组合。而不同的多重签名方案可能会根据具体需求进行不同的设置。
下面是实现多重签名的基本步骤:
- 生成密钥:每位参与者生成自己的私钥和公钥,并交换公钥以进行后续的组合。
- 创建多重签名地址:使用所有公钥创建一个多重签名地址。
- 发送比特币到多重签名地址:将比特币存入该地址。
- 发起交易:若需要消费比特币,需由多个参与者签名以创建有效交易。
在每个交易中,签名的过程需要相应的参与者提供其私钥进行签名,最终的交易只有在满足至少规定数量的签名后才会被添加到区块链上。
三、多重签名的优势与不足
多重签名技术的优势主要表现在以下几个方面:
- 安全性高:对比单一签名,多重签名显著提升了账户安全性,减少了单点故障风险。
- 灵活性:用户可以自定义需要签名的参与者数量,适应不同需求,使得资产管理更具灵活性。
- 共享控制:适合企业或团队使用,通过共享控制降低了因个体私钥丢失所带来的风险。
然而,多重签名也并非没有缺陷:
- 复杂性:多重签名的设置和管理相对复杂,对用户的技术水平有一定要求,可能导致操作上的误差。
- 延迟性:由于需要多个签名,交易的确认时间可能较长。
- 丢失如果参与多签的公钥丢失,可能导致无法完成交易。
四、多重签名的应用场景
多重签名的应用场景几乎涵盖了数字资产管理的多个方面:
- 企业钱包管理:企业通常需要多个决策者共同管理公司的数字资产,以做好财务审核和资金管理。
- 交易所风险控制:许多交易所都会采用多重签名技术来确保用户资金的安全,避免因单一关键人员的不当行为造成的损失。
- 家庭钱包:家庭成员可以共同管理家庭的数字资产,防止资金意外丢失和盗窃。
- 去中心化金融(DeFi):在DeFi平台中,多重签名可以帮助用户共同控制智能合约的资产。
五、相关问题解答
如何设置多重签名钱包?
设置多重签名钱包是一个相对简单但需要认真对待的过程。以下为详细步骤:
- 选择钱包软件:目前有很多支持多重签名的钱包软件,如Electrum、Armory、Bitcoin Core等,用户需选择一款合适的。
- 创建参与者私钥:所有参与者需要创建自己的私钥和公钥,一旦生成,确保私钥安全存放。
- 生成多重签名地址:使用所有参与者的公钥,通过钱包软件生成一个多重签名地址,常见的设置包括2-of-3或3-of-5等。
- 进行测试:在往多重签名地址里存入真实资金前,建议先用小额进行测试以确保设置正常。
- 设置交易权限:明确每个参与者的交易签名权限,以顾及参与者可能的变动。
在这个过程中,重要的是每个参与者都需对私钥负责。如需创建更高级的访问规则,可以考虑使用一些专业的多重签名方案。
多重签名钱包的安全性如何保障?
保障多重签名钱包的安全性涉及到多个方面:
- 私钥保护:确保每位参与者对自有私钥进行安全保存,例如使用硬件钱包、冷钱包等。此外,避免将私钥存放在任何可能被黑客攻击的云端存储平台上。
- 参与者身份验证:加强对参与者身份的验证,确保所有参与者的安全性和信任度,降低内部风险。
- 备份与恢复:定期备份所有公钥和多重签名设置,以便在必要时快速恢复钱包访问权限。
- 监控活动:定期监控钱包的所有交易活动,及时发现和处理异常情况。
保障安全的关键在于强调设计的严谨性与参与者的责任感。即使多重签名提供了额外的保护,但实施该技术时也不可掉以轻心。
多重签名钱包的信任机制如何运作?
多重签名钱包的信任机制主要体现在这些参与者相互之间需要建立信任关系。通过设定合理的参与者数量及签名比例,用户可以在不同的信任级别上做出决策:
- 信任但不依赖:参与者间可以信任彼此,但为了防止潜在的欺诈行为,需都参与到资产管理中即使不完全依赖某个参与者。
- 防止单点故障:通过多重签名设计,可以有效防止由于单个参与者的不负责任行为、故障或恶意行为带来的损失。
- 参与者替代机制:若某个参与者不能继续参与(如疾病、丢失私钥等),要考虑如何顺利更换人员,以防止资产被冻结。
- 定期审核机制:设定定期审核和会议,确保所有参与者仍然保持信任并遵循协议。
信任机制的建立是多重签名钱包运作的基石,合理设置参与者关系及自治规则将极大增强资产管理的可靠性。
未来多重签名技术的发展趋势如何?
随着区块链技术和加密货币市场的不断发展,多重签名技术也在不断演进,以下是未来的一些发展趋势:
- 更高的安全性:未来的多重签名技术将结合生物识别、人工智能等新兴技术,以提升安全性和用户体验。
- 方便易用:随着技术的进步,用户对此领域的接受度可能提升,简单易用的多重签名钱包将逐渐成为市场的主流。
- 智能合约集成:多重签名技术将与智能合约深度结合,进一步拓展其应用场景,推动类似DeFi等新型业务模式的发展。
- 与国家监管的结合:未来可能会出现与国家法律法规相结合的多重签名系统,以符合合规要求,从而在更多官方场景下发生应用。
从整体来看,多重签名技术不仅是数字资产安全的重要保障,更可能成为未来去中心化数字经济的重要支柱。
综上所述,多重签名钱包在比特币及其他加密货币的管理中扮演着极为重要的角色。随着用户对安全的需求加大,多重签名作为安全技术中的一种趋势,将进一步推动数字货币的健康发展。